<B>1855 G$1 MS64 NGC.</B></I> Satiny surfaces are combined with a strike that is far finer than seen on many Type Two gold dollars and make for a pleasing example of this rare issue. In fact, as the photos show, the feathers of the headdress are individually sharp in detail, and the central DOLLAR denomination is nicely outlined and each letter well formed. The coin is sheathed in light gold toning, beneath which the luster gleams softly. Only tiny abrasions keep this from an even higher grade. The reverse shows evidence of die clashing, while on the obverse the Indian's portrait is faintly outlined in clashed "shadows" of the reverse wreath. An excellent coin for a type set. While the original mintage was sizable, precious few have survived as fine as this piece.
